Vistarta and the Fai together for the spring days
Share on FacebookShare on Twitter


Also this year Vistarta renews its commitment to the Italian cultural and landscape heritage by supporting FAI – Fund for the Italian environment the occasion of the spring days. Saturday 22 and Sunday 23 March the Visrta will gara open some of its spaces to the public, offering a rich program of guided tours and special events to celebrate the beauty and history of the territory, all accompanied by the wines of its winery.

An expected appointment that allows visitors to discover one of the most fascinating jewels of Friuli Venezia Giulia. Located a causa di the village of Vistarta (PN) a causa di Sacile, it is a causa di fact a historical home of neoclassical style completed a causa di 1872 and surrounded by a magnificent park of seven hectares, designed a causa di the 60s by the famous English landscapeist Russell Page. Owned by the Brandolini d’Adda family since 1780, the villaggio is the heart of a seal devoted to organic viticulture and the conservation of the landscape. The park, full of centuries -old trees and mirrors of , is part of the Great Italian Gardens circuit. A place where history, nature and agricultural tradition merge harmoniously, making it one of the gems of Friuli Venezia Giulia.

During the two days, it will be possible to participate a causa di guided paths to discover the history of the , between nature and architecture, and deepen the link between Vistarta and the protection of the environmental heritage.

Saturday 22 and Sunday 23 March will be dedicated to the guided tours of the park and the , available from 9:00 to 18:00. Visitors will be able to explore gardens, monumental trees and part of the historic home through immersive paths lasting about 40 minutes.

The Spring Days of Fai represent a unique opportunity to discover places of extraordinary beauty, often not accessible to the public, and to contribute to the Mission of the Foundation a causa di preserving and enhancing the historical and environmental heritage of our country as the Vistrica , offering an immersion a causa di history, architecture and tradition of the territory.

All appointments are free and do not require booking.
